About
Antirrhinum Luminaire White Improved ('Balumwhitim') is a bushy cultivar of the Antirrhinum genus, which includes annuals, perennials, or sub-shrubs with simple foliage and tubular, two-lipped flowers. This herbaceous perennial or annual biennial thrives in full sun on south-facing, sheltered sites with fertile, well-drained loam soil of neutral pH. It is deciduous and flowers in spring and summer, making it suitable for bedding, borders, and cut flowers. The plant is hardy to UK zone H3 and can be propagated by seed or softwood cuttings.
About the genus
Antirrhinum is a genus of plants in the Plantaginaceae family, commonly known as dragon flowers or snapdragons because of the flowers' fancied resemblance to the face of a dragon that opens and closes its mouth when laterally squeezed. They are also sometimes called toadflax or dog flower. They are native to rocky areas of Europe, the United States, Canada, and North Africa.

Is Antirrhinum Luminaire White Improved ('Balumwhitim') hardy in the UK?
Antirrhinum Luminaire White Improved ('Balumwhitim') has an RHS hardiness rating of H3, meaning it is half-hardy, tolerating -5 to 1°C, and may need winter protection in colder areas.
